Popular Bed-in-a-Box Materials
Online mattress companies utilize various materials to create different sleep experiences. Memory foam remains one of the most popular choices, known for its pressure-relieving properties and body contouring. Many brands now incorporate cooling technologies into their memory foam mattresses to address heat retention concerns. Hybrid mattresses combine foam layers with pocketed coils, offering both support and comfort. Latex mattresses, made from natural or synthetic rubber, provide a responsive and durable sleep surface with good temperature regulation.
Key Features to Consider
When comparing online mattress companies, several factors should influence your decision. Firmness levels typically range from soft to firm, with medium-firm being the most versatile option for various sleep positions. Edge support is important for those who sit or sleep near the edge of the bed. Motion isolation is crucial for couples, preventing disturbance when one person moves. Temperature regulation features help maintain a comfortable sleeping environment throughout the night.
Comparison of Top Bed-in-a-Box Brands
| Brand | Mattress Type | Firmness Options | Trial Period | Warranty | Price Range (Queen)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Casper | Foam/Hybrid | Medium, Medium Firm | 100 nights | 10 years | $1,095-$2,295 |
| Purple | Hyper-Elastic Polymer | Medium, Medium Firm | 100 nights | 10 years | $1,399-$2,598 |
| Nectar | Memory Foam | Medium Firm | 365 nights | Forever | $799-$1,699 |
| Tuft & Needle | Adaptive Foam | Medium | 100 nights | 10 years | $895-$1,595 |
| Leesa | Foam/Hybrid | Medium | 100 nights | 10 years | $1,099-$1,999 |
Purchasing and Delivery Process
Buying from online mattress companies is typically straightforward. Customers select their preferred mattress size and model, complete the purchase online, and receive the compressed mattress within a few business days. Most brands offer free shipping and handle the delivery process efficiently. The mattress arrives in a compact box, making it easy to maneuver through tight spaces. Once unboxed, the mattress expands to its full size within hours, though some brands recommend waiting 24-48 hours for complete expansion.
Trial Periods and Return Policies
One of the biggest advantages of bed-in-a-box brands is their generous trial periods, allowing customers to test the mattress in their own home. Trial lengths vary by company, ranging from 100 nights to a full year. If unsatisfied, most brands offer free returns and full refunds, though some may charge a small pickup fee. The return process typically involves contacting customer service to arrange mattress pickup and disposal. Many companies donate returned mattresses to local charities rather than sending them to landfills.
Warranty Coverage
Online mattress companies generally offer substantial warranty coverage, typically ranging from 10 years to lifetime protection. Warranties usually cover manufacturing defects such as sagging beyond a certain depth or material flaws. Some brands offer prorated coverage after the initial period, while others maintain full replacement value throughout the warranty term. It’s important to review warranty terms carefully, as most require proper foundation support and regular mattress rotation to maintain coverage.
